混元大模型,一个近年来在人工智能领域备受关注的概念,它以“元宝”这一形象深入人心。本文将深入解析混元大模型背后的秘密,探讨其未来潜力,以及它如何引领人工智能的发展。
一、混元大模型简介
混元大模型是一种基于深度学习技术的大型语言模型,它通过学习海量的文本数据,能够生成连贯、自然的语言文本。混元大模型的核心优势在于其强大的语言理解和生成能力,这使得它在文本摘要、机器翻译、智能客服等多个领域具有广泛的应用前景。
二、混元大模型的秘密
1. 架构设计
混元大模型采用了多层次的神经网络结构,包括编码器和解码器。编码器负责将输入的文本转换为模型可理解的内部表示,而解码器则负责根据内部表示生成相应的文本输出。
class Encoder(nn.Module):
def __init__(self, vocab_size, embedding_dim, hidden_dim):
super(Encoder, self).__init__()
self.embedding = nn.Embedding(vocab_size, embedding_dim)
self.rnn = nn.LSTM(embedding_dim, hidden_dim)
def forward(self, input):
embedded = self.embedding(input)
output, (hidden, cell) = self.rnn(embedded)
return output, hidden, cell
class Decoder(nn.Module):
def __init__(self, vocab_size, embedding_dim, hidden_dim):
super(Decoder, self).__init__()
self.embedding = nn.Embedding(vocab_size, embedding_dim)
self.rnn = nn.LSTM(embedding_dim + hidden_dim, hidden_dim)
self.fc = nn.Linear(hidden_dim, vocab_size)
def forward(self, input, hidden):
embedded = self.embedding(input)
embedding = torch.cat((embedded, hidden[-1].unsqueeze(0)), 1)
output, hidden = self.rnn(embedding)
output = self.fc(output)
return output, hidden
2. 数据处理
混元大模型在训练过程中使用了大规模的文本数据集,通过预训练和微调,使得模型能够理解和生成多种语言的文本。
3. 模型优化
为了提高模型的性能,研究人员采用了多种优化策略,如Adam优化器、梯度裁剪、学习率预热等。
三、混元大模型的应用前景
1. 文本摘要
混元大模型可以应用于自动生成文章摘要,提高信息获取效率。
2. 机器翻译
混元大模型在机器翻译领域的应用具有显著优势,能够实现高质量的跨语言翻译。
3. 智能客服
混元大模型可以用于构建智能客服系统,提供更加人性化的服务。
四、结论
混元大模型作为人工智能领域的一项重要成果,具有广阔的应用前景。随着技术的不断发展,我们有理由相信,混元大模型将在更多领域发挥重要作用,为人类创造更多价值。